CB's blog

Архив рубрики 'JavaScript'

JavaScript - добавление строк в таблицу

Пятница, Май 12th, 2006

Еще одна заметка о AJAX - подобных интерфейсах. Не так давно я написал о том, как можно удалять строки из таблиц с помощью JavaScript. С тех пор статистика переходов поисковиков показала что нужно сделать и заметку посвященную добавлению, так как Яндекс, например, по запросу "javascript добавить строку в таблицу" (без кавычек) первым выдавал мою статью
"CB’s blog " Архив блога " JavaScript - удаление строк из таблиц. Часть 1". Теперь я исправляю ситуацию. Постараюсь максимально коротко описать что к чему, не буду описывать серверную часть, а только интерфейс. В конце заметки - работающий пример.

(more…)

JavaScript - удаление строк из таблиц. Часть 2 – AJAX

Четверг, Март 30th, 2006

Я продолжаю цикл заметок, посвященных AJAX. Удаление строк из таблиц – это простой и удобный способ “прикручивания” аякса к любому сайту, где есть таблицы, генерируемые из БД. А это в свою очередь сказывается на удобстве интерфейса и особенно на скорости его работы. Вторая часть – AJAX – расскажет как реализовать удаление строк из базы данных.

(more…)

JavaScript - удаление строк из таблиц. Часть 1 – клиентская

Четверг, Март 9th, 2006

Я начинаю цикл заметок, посвященных AJAX. Удаление строк из таблиц – это простой и удобный способ “прикручивания” аякса к любому сайту, где есть таблицы, генерируемые из БД. А это в свою очередь сказывается на удобстве интерфейса и особенно на скорости его работы. Первая часть – клиентская – расскажет как реализовать удаление строк средствами DOM.

(more…)

sorttable. JavaScript - сортировка таблиц

Четверг, Февраль 23rd, 2006

Все мы постоянно встречаемся с табличными данными. Зачастую таблицы состоят из десятков строк, и работать с ними намного удобнее, отсортировав данные. В то же время, большинство из тех сортировок таблиц что мне приходилось видеть сводилась к следующему: после клика по заголовку столбца на сервер посылается запрос с кодом этого заголовка, далее скрипт, выводящий таблицу выбирал данные из БД ORDER BY соответственное поле (например http://forum.ixbt.com/?id=36&sort=topic). Далее все это передавалось пользователю. Цель этой заметки – рассказать о другом методе сортировки таблиц, который базируется на DOM.

(more…)

Полосатые таблицы

Пятница, Февраль 17th, 2006

“Повторение - мать учения” – основная причина написания этой заметки. Внимательный читатель сразу же может заметить мол сколько можно, тема раскрыта и точка, надоели повторы, практически то же самое скорее всего можно почитать тут (en), тут (рус) и тут (рус), а также додуматься самому при возникновении необходимости в сабже. Но я считаю, что соотношения пользы нижеизложенного кода к размеру в байтах так велико, что лучше прочитать еще раз, выучить наизусть, найти все баги, и в конце-концов повесить в рамочку под стеклом. Javascript now works, и пока так есть, надо этим интенсивно пользоваться.

(more…)